Introduction

Fly worry can cause problems around eyes, lips, nostrils and genital areas. Horse and stable flies will multiply in manure, rotting foodstuffs, etc.

Control

  • Stable hygiene, proper and thorough disposal of muck and siting of muck heaps are all important in reducing these pests
  • Fly veils, masks and bonnets can be used
